What you'll do at work

Panda London is based in Hendon, a short walk from Hendon Central Station. Our team of customer service agents is based in Serbia or the UK. During your initial training, this role requires working four days per week in our Hendon office and one day from home. You will work alongside two UK team members and closely partner with the wider operations team to resolve customer queries.

Job Summary:

To provide friendly, timely and accurate customer service across phone, email and social media and live chat, taking ownership of enquiries through to resolution and delivering a level of service that reflects Panda London’s premium products and brand values.

Key Responsibilities & duties:

  • Recording customer interactions accurately in our systems and taking ownership of enquiries through to resolution within the agreed service level agreement
  • Keeping customers updated and escalating complaints or more complex cases appropriately
  • Liaising with the warehouse, delivery partners and retail/marketplace partners to resolve issues
  • Following the relevant refund, returns, warranty, data-protection and confidentiality procedures
  • Identifying recurring customer feedback and sharing it with the wider team to help improve products and processes

What you'll learn

Course contents

  • Use a range of questioning skills, including listening and responding in a way that builds rapport, determines customer needs and expectations and achieves positive engagement and delivery.
  • Depending on your job role and work environment: Use appropriate verbal and non-verbal communication skills, along with summarising language during face-to-face communications; and/or
  • Depending on your job role and work environment: Use appropriate communication skills, along with reinforcement techniques (to confirm understanding) during non-facing customer interactions.
  • Depending on your job role and work environment: Use an appropriate ‘tone of voice’ in all communications, including written and digital, that reflect the organisation’s brand.
  • Provide clear explanations and offer options in order to help customers make choices that are mutually beneficial to both the customer and your organisation.
  • Be able to organise yourself, prioritise your own workload/activity and work to meet deadlines.
  • Demonstrate patience and calmness.
  • Show you understand the customer’s point of view.
  • Use appropriate sign-posting or resolution to meet your customers needs and manage expectations.
  • Maintain informative communication during service recovery.

Training schedule

As part of your Apprenticeship, you will be enrolled onto a nationally recognised Level 2 Customer Service Practitioner via our training partner, Learning Skills Partnership. Your Apprenticeship typically takes 15 months to complete and is fully supported through work-based learning, this means that all training is done at the workplace eliminating the need to attend college. The successful candidate will be allocated a tutor who will provide a mixture of interactive online group teaching and 1-1 training monthly.

About this employer

Back in 2015 when we set up Panda, manufacturing luxury homeware products often involved animals and damaging the environment. So our mission was simple — to design and craft revolutionary new products that feel incredible without costing the earth. We needed to find a material as soft as Egyptian cotton. We also needed a duvet filling as light and fluffy as duck or goose down. Both had to be eco-friendly to source, manufacture and recycle. Having searched all over the world, in the forests of South East Asia, we found it...Bamboo.

Sensuously soft, anti-bacterial and hypoallergenic. Highly breathable to keep you cool in the summer and warm in the winter, bamboo fabric has outstanding natural properties. Apply the latest Panda technology, innovation and meticulous design and you have the most seriously sumptuous bedding and homeware you can buy — better, even, than the traditional alternatives we set out to match!

The world's most luxurious experience for your home, through the pioneering use of bamboo, the world's most eco-friendly material. That's the Panda promise.
